Pop singer Lily Allen has come forward saying the secret behind Hollywood's

size zero standard is "not eating".

The just-married star expressed her concern over the unobtainable figures of most Hollywood stars, hinting that drugs play a large part and that "people in America aren't normal".

"(People) are taking speed not to eat. In America everyone abuses that Adderall stuff," she told ELLE magazine.

While Allen says she is happy with her body at the moment, she admits it wasn't always the case.

"(I went through a stage) where I wasn't eating. [I was] going out at night. I guess when you’re not eating you have to distract yourself with other things.

"Come three o'clock it was like, 'Oh I suppose it's acceptable to have a glass of wine.' And then by four o'clock I would have had four glasses. It's not the way to be."

Allen adds that up until 2007, she prided herself on healthy body image, but eventually Hollywood took over and she became "victim to the evil machine".

Allen's husband, Sam Cooper, is credited with turning Allen's lifestyle around.

"Sam is really down to earth," a source told The Sun UK. "He grafts hard for a living as a painter and decorator and leads a totally normal life. Lily is completely smitten with him."
